Job Role Description Skills Required
Grid Communications Engineer Design, implement, and maintain robust grid communication systems. Focus on network optimization and security within the UK energy sector. Network Engineering, Grid Integration, Cybersecurity, SCADA
Smart Grid Data Analyst Analyze large datasets from smart grid infrastructure to optimize energy distribution and consumption patterns. Expertise in data visualization is crucial. Data Analysis, Python, SQL, Machine Learning, Energy Markets
Grid Communications Architect Develop and implement high-level architecture for grid communication networks. Lead design and implementation, ensuring scalability and reliability. Network Architecture, Cloud Computing, IoT, Protocol Design, Smart Grid Technologies
Cybersecurity Specialist (Grid Infrastructure) Protect critical grid infrastructure from cyber threats. Implement security protocols and conduct vulnerability assessments. Cybersecurity, Penetration Testing, Risk Management, Network Security, Compliance

An Advanced Skill Certificate in Grid Communications equips professionals with in-depth knowledge and practical skills in designing, implementing, and managing complex grid communication networks. The program focuses on the latest technologies and protocols used in smart grids, providing participants with a competitive edge in the energy sector.


Learning outcomes include mastery of grid communication protocols such as IEC 61850, DNP3, and Modbus. Participants will gain hands-on experience with network security and cybersecurity best practices for resilient grid operations, crucial for preventing outages and ensuring reliable power delivery. Furthermore, the curriculum covers advanced topics in data analytics and SCADA systems integration, vital for efficient grid management.
